Why Restoration Matters More Than Ever in the Bay Area


Over the last few decades, the San Francisco Bay has actually weathered the influence of urban growth, commercial advancement, and environment modification. Once teeming with wild animals and lavish marshes, most of the bay's natural ecological communities have actually been fragmented or weakened. Yet amid these difficulties, something impressive is taking place: local homeowners, volunteers, and grassroots initiatives are leading a wave of ecological restoration that's bringing new life back to the Bay.


Reconstruction isn't almost planting trees or cleaning up trash, though those initiatives are essential. It's about reconstructing the structures of life, from marsh turfs that sustain fish nurseries to coastline buffers that defend against flooding. And in this region, the power of area involvement is turning the trend really realistically.


From Marshland to Miracle: The Return of Native Habitats


Among the most noticeable adjustments happening in the Bay Area is the re-emergence of native environments. Wetlands that were once drained or paved over are being rehydrated and replanted. Yards and bushes native to the area are being grown by neighborhood teams, who frequently count on local volunteers to help expand seed startings and manage regulated planting events.


These native plants do greater than add plant to the landscape. They offer sanctuary to migratory birds, pollinators, and little mammals, developing pockets of biodiversity in the middle of busy city areas. As these habitats expand, so does the environmental health of the Bay itself. When regional homeowners take time out of their weekends to get their hands in the soil, they're not simply growing-- they're participating in the restoration of a living, breathing ecological community.
